Given fractions are 8409/263,9758/489
Formula to find GCF of Fractions is
GCF =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ators
As per the formula GCF of Fractions let’s split into two parts and find the GCF of Numerators and LCM of Denominators
In the given fractions GCF of Numerators means GCF of 8409,9758
Greatest Common Factor of Numerators i.e. GCF of 8409,9758 is 1 .
LCM of Denominators means LCM of 263,489 as per the given fractions.
LCM of 263,489 is 128607 as it is the smallest common factor for both these numbers.
Lets's calculate GCF of 8409,9758
∴ So GCF of numbers is 1 because of no common factors present between them.
Factors of 8409
List of positive integer factors of 8409 that divides 8409 without a remainder.
1,3,2803,8409
Factors of 9758
List of positive integer factors of 9758 that divides 9758 without a remainder.
1,2,7,14,17,34,41,82,119,238,287,574,697,1394,4879,9758
Greatest Common Factor
We found the factors 8409,9758 . The biggest common factor number is the GCF number.
So the greatest common factor 8409,9758 is 1.
Lets's calculate LCM of 263,489
Given numbers has no common factors except 1. So, there LCM is their product i.e 128607
Thus GCF of Fractions =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ators = 1/128607
Therefore, the GCF of Fractions 8409/263,9758/489 is 1/128607
